Citizens Advice North East Derbyshire is looking for a dedicated individual to join their team as a Community Engagement Coordinator for the Energy Advice service. This role involves coordinating outreach activities, building relationships with local partners, and providing support to residents managing energy costs.

With a salary range of £25,877 – £28,644 and a fixed-term contract until June 2027, this is an exciting opportunity to make a difference in the community. The position requires strong organizational skills and confidence in working with people.

How to prepare for a job interview at Citizens Advice North East Derbyshire

✨Know Your Community

Familiarise yourself with the local area and its energy challenges. Research recent initiatives or partnerships Citizens Advice North East Derbyshire has been involved in. This will show your genuine interest in the role and help you connect your experiences to their mission.

✨Showcase Your Organisational Skills

Prepare examples of how you've successfully coordinated outreach activities in the past.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ses, highlighting your ability to manage multiple tasks and work effectively with various stakeholders.

✨Build Rapport with Interviewers

Since this role involves working closely with people, demonstrate your interpersonal skills during the interview. Be friendly, engage in active listening, and ask thoughtful questions about the team and their current projects to create a positive connection.

✨Prepare for Scenario Questions

Anticipate questions that may involve real-life scenarios related to energy advice and community engagement. Think about how you would handle specific situations, such as supporting a resident struggling with energy costs, and be ready to discuss your approach.
